10 Lines on First Battle of Panipat

Posted on by GURU
  1. The First Battle of Panipat was fought in 1526 between the forces of Babur and the Sultan of Delhi, Ibrahim Lodi.
  2. Babur was a descendant of Genghis Khan and Timur, while Ibrahim Lodi was the last Sultan of the Delhi Sultanate.
  3. The battle was fought near Panipat, a city in present-day Haryana, India.
  4. Babur had a smaller army than Ibrahim Lodi but had superior artillery and firearms.
  5. The battle lasted for several hours, and both sides suffered heavy casualties.
  6. Babur’s army ultimately emerged victorious, and Ibrahim Lodi was killed in the battle.
  7. This victory gave Babur control over Delhi and paved the way for the Mughal Empire in India.
  8. The battle marked the end of the Delhi Sultanate and the beginning of the Mughal Empire’s reign in India.
  9. The battle was significant in Indian history, as it marked a significant shift in power and paved the way for the Mughal Empire’s expansion in India.
  10. The First Battle of Panipat remains an important event in Indian history, and its legacy can still be felt in the region today.
